Compare Antilles School of Technical Careers and ICPR Junior College

Both Antilles School of Technical Careers and ICPR Junior College are Private, 2-4 years schools located in Puerto Rico. The following statements compare Antilles School of Technical Careers and ICPR Junior College with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Antilles School of Technical Careers's tuition ($12,690) is more expensive than ICPR Junior ($8,664).
  • Antilles School of Technical Careers's students to faculty ratio (20 to 1) is lower than ICPR Junior (21 to 1).
  • ICPR Junior (424 students) is larger than Antilles School of Technical Careers (286 students) with more enrolled students.
  • ICPR Junior ($7,652) has higher amount of financial aid than Antilles School of Technical Careers ($6,001).
  • ICPR Junior's graduation rate (61%) is higher than Antilles School of Technical Careers (59%).
